I’ve been in Australia for nearly three and a half months now have seen pretty much the whole East Coast except for Sydney. Even though I’ve only spend a little over half of my savings so far, I’ve started job searching. It’s going to be winter soon and I’d rather work in the winter and continue traveling next spring.

My job searching was pretty easy, I googled “treeplanting in Australia” and found a company that plants in New South Wales and is looking for planters for their May-August contracts. Tree planters in Australia plant in much nicer land than what I planted on a couple of summers ago in Timmins and also get paid more. So I’ve been in contact with them over email and it looks like I’ve got a job for the next four months. The boss rents out houses in the town (I forgot the name, it’s in an email) and only charges his planters $280/month rent. They supply all your planting equipment but you have to buy your own food and I’m going to have to buy some steeled toed boots and all that stuff.

I haven’t worked since January, so I’m looking forward to working and seeing the bank account go up instead of down. They said the average planter makes about $300/day and top planters make upwards of $450/day. I have no idea if that’s true or not, but we plant 7 days/week so I’m sure I can make some good coin.
